First, I wanted to congratulate you on your Hollingsworth blog and the history you shared on your family line. Our Hollingsworth database (with over 60,000 descendants of Valentine and their spouses) confirms your line down to your grandmother.
I wanted to share that ongoing research and new DNA evidence uncovered by DVHSS and other allied Hollingsworth researchers indicates that the family is likely of Norman origin. Valentine's father was named Henry Hollingsworth, and he first shows up in a Muster Roll in County Armagh in today's Northern Ireland in 1630. Valentine's birth to Henry and wife Katherine (last name unknown) shows up in Quaker records in 1632.There is also no credible, source data backed evidence as to who Henry's father was, but it was certainly not Robert Hollingworth of Hollingworth Hall based on parish records and DNA. Also, Hollingworth Hall was demolished during WWII, but the local parish church, with its Hollingworth wing, does still stand with a stained glass window that has the Hollingworth COA of the last owner of Hollingworth Hall before it was sold out of the family.
